WSU Athletics Deans' Award winners announced
Each April for 19 consecutive years (2001-19), the Wayne State University Department of Athletics has held its annual Academic Recognition luncheon to honor those student-athletes who received at least a 3.5 term GPA for the fall semester of that particular academic year.
Winners have been announced online in place of a luncheon to recognize those individuals who earned the Deans' Award for having the highest cumulative GPA among all student-athletes in that particular college.
The Mike Ilitch School of Business Athletics Deans’ Award winner is Alexis Miller.
Miller was a sophomore on the women's basketball team last year (2019-20). A finance major, she was a GLIAC All-Academic Excellence Team selection in 2020. Miller has earned a spot on the Athletic Director's Honor Roll (term GPA 3.5+) all four semesters at WSU with a 4.00 term GPA every semester. A 2019-20 recipient of the D2 ADA Academic Achievement Award, she was also a CoSIDA Academic All-District nominee this past season. Miller has played in 59 career games in two years, totaling 199 points, 102 rebounds and 92 assists.
